Topics Tab
Topics are labels that categorize conversations by subject. The Topic Analyzer assigns them automatically, and you can also apply them manually from the conversation sidebar.Creating a Topic

Hierarchical Topics
Topics support parent/child relationships. For example:- Support (parent)
- Billing Support (child)
- Technical Support (child)
- Sales (parent)
- Upsell (child)
- New Lead (child)
Editing and Deleting Topics
- Click a topic row to edit its name, description, keywords, or parent
- Click the delete button to remove a topic
Deleting a topic removes it from future analysis but does not remove the tag from conversations that were already tagged with it.
Admin Tags Tab
Admin tags are internal labels visible only to staff members. They help you categorize conversations for team workflows — for example, “Knowledge Gap”, “Bug Report”, or “VIP Customer”.Creating an Admin Tag
- Click Add Tag
- Enter the tag name and optional description
- Optionally assign a color for the badge
- Click Save
Admin Status Tab
Admin statuses are custom status labels for conversations — for example, “Under Investigation”, “Escalated”, or “Resolved”. They help you track conversation progress through your workflow.Creating an Admin Status
- Click Add Status
- Enter the status name and optional description
- Optionally assign a color
- Click Save

Best Practices
- Start with 10-20 topics — too many dilutes the analysis; too few misses important patterns
- Use descriptive names — “billing-support” is clearer than “category-3” for both humans and the AI
- Add keywords for predictable terms — if users always mention “invoice” for billing topics, add it as a keyword for fast matching
- Use hierarchy for structure — group related topics under a parent to keep the Topics Analytics treemap readable
- Review quarterly — merge low-volume topics, split high-volume ones that cover too many subjects
